What is Schools Applitrack?

Schools Applitrack is an online applicant tracking system (ATS) widely used by school districts to manage job postings and applications. It allows schools to streamline the hiring process by collecting, organizing, and reviewing applications electronically. Job seekers can use Applitrack to search for open positions, submit application materials, and track the status of their applications. School administrators benefit from tools that help them manage candidate information, communicate with applicants, and ensure compliance with hiring policies.

How does the application process work for candidates applying through Applitrack for school district positions?

When applying for school district positions via Applitrack, candidates typically create an online profile, submit required documents, and select desired job postings. The platform allows applicants to track their application status, receive notifications, and sometimes complete district-specific questionnaires. School HR teams review submissions and may contact candidates for interviews or further steps. It's important to ensure all materials are uploaded and information is accurate, as incomplete applications may not be considered.
